Scope of studying aeronautical engineering in the USA

  • Aeronautical engineering is a highly advanced branch of aerospace engineering that enhances human science and technology.
  • This industry is popular among international students who are passionate about exploring different fields like aviation, spacecraft, and other related machinery.

Aeronautical engineering studies the design, development, testing, monitoring, and production of spacecraft, aircraft, and satellites. The field of study is a part of aerospace engineering along with astronautic engineering.

  • The USA is one of the top study destinations for aeronautical engineering, as the country has some of the finest educational institutions that offer students great resources to support the theoretical and practical aspects of the program.
  • The USA has a well-established aerospace industry with over 5,400 companies across the country. According to the US Bureau of Labor Statistics, the job market for aerospace engineers is expected to rise 6% between 2022 and 2032.

Subjects in aeronautical engineering

  • Maths
  • Physics
  • Aerodynamics
  • Material science
  • Aircraft structures
  • Fluid dynamics
  • Aircraft control
  • Mechanics
  • Propulsion
  • Flight communications
  • Aircraft structure
  • Control engineering
  • Aircraft transportation system

What are the visa requirements for aeronautical engineering courses in the USA?

VisaCost
F1 student visa$510. This is for the F1 student visa and includes a $350 SEVIS fee, and a $160 application fee.

Career opportunities after pursuing aeronautics engineering in the USA

The field of aerospace has various career options for international students. The opportunities offer rewarding growth and high-paying professions.

The average annual salary of an Aeronautical Engineer is around $130,000. Fresh graduates earn over $101,326, while experienced employees earn $168,400 annually.

Here are some of the top career options for aeronautical engineering graduates in the USA.

  • Aeronautical Engineer
  • Aerospace Engineer
  • Academic Researcher
  • Academic Lecturer
  • Maintenance Engineer
  • Design Engineer
  • System Verification Engineer
  • Flight System Engineer
  • Mechanical Engineer
  • Computer-Aided Design (CAD) Technician

Top employers in the USA for aeronautical engineering graduates

  • NASA
  • Atlas Air
  • SpaceX
  • Boeing
  • BAE Systems, Inc.
  • Rolls Royce
  • Lockheed Martin
  • Raytheon
  • General Electric
  • Northrop Grumman
  • General Dynamics
